Kinds Of Pram Pushchairs
Before diving into selection requirements, it's important to familiarize yourself with the different types of pram pushchairs offered. The following table sums up the main types and their crucial features:
| Type | Description |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|---|
| Classic Pram | Conventional design with a large bassinet and strong frame. | Elegant look, comfortable for newborns. | Can be large and heavy. |
| Travel System | Includes a suitable car seat that attaches to the pram frame. | Convenient for moms and dads on-the-go. | Limited use as the kid grows. |
| Lightweight/Compact | Developed for simple maneuverability and storage; often collapsible. | Perfect for city living and public transportation. | May lack durability and features. |
| All-Terrain | Developed for rugged surface areas; bigger wheels and suspension. | Great for daring families. | Heavier and hard to steer in tight spaces. |
| Double Pram | Accommodates two children, typically with side-by-side or tandem seating setups. | Perfect for twins or siblings of various ages. | Heavier and may take up more space. |
Key Features to Consider
When choosing a pram pushchair, there are a number of functions to bear in mind. Below is a list of essential aspects to consider:
- Safety: Ensure that the pram complies with safety standards, has a five-point harness, and features a reputable braking system.
- Weight and Maneuverability: A light-weight pram is often simpler to handle, specifically when browsing through crowded areas.
- Foldability: Look for a model that folds quickly and compactly for storage and transport.
- Convenience: Ensure the pram has great suspension, cushioned seating, and appropriate canopy protection for sun protection.
- Storage: Check for an adequate under-seat storage basket to accommodate diaper bags, groceries, or other fundamentals.
- Adjustable Features: Consider prams that have adjustable handles, reclining seats, and detachable canopies for included flexibility.
- Resilience: Look for high-quality products that can stand up to routine usage over a number of years.

Pram Pushchair Care and Maintenance
To guarantee your pram stays in great condition, routine upkeep is important. Here are some ideas on how to care for your pram:
- Cleaning: Wipe down the frame and fabrics regularly, and follow the maker's directions for deep cleansing.
- Lubrication: Keep wheels and moving parts well-lubricated to guarantee smooth operation.
- Inspect for Wear and Tear: Regularly examine straps, wheels, and joints for any indications of damage.
- Shop Properly: When not in use, store the pram in a dry location to prevent mold and rust.
